NVIDIA GeForce 7950 GX2 Preview - Page 1 of 4

INTRODUCTION

Today, NVIDIA is raising the performance bar for a single graphics card by announcing the availability of the GeForce 7950 Graphics Processing Unit (GPU). The GeForce 7950 is comprised of two GPUs on a single graphics card that work together to deliver unprecedented 3D performance. Graphics cards based on the the GeForce 7950 will carry the "GX2" suffix and range in price from $599 to $649.

Although the GeForce 7950 GX2 is referred to as a dual-PCB design, the graphics card features a single PCI Express x16 connector. The GeForce 7950 also distinguishes itself by working, in a single graphics card configuration, on PCI Express compliant motherboards with a properly configured system BIOS (SBIOS).

The BIOS updates include support for PCI Express switching, which is an integral part of the technology behind the GeForce 7950 GX2. SLI technology allows two GeForce 7950 GX2-based graphics cards to be used in forming a quad-SLI configuration, which continues to be a feature exclusive to system builders. However, NVIDIA does have plans to bring quad-SLI technology to consumers through other channels in the near future.

SPECIFICATIONS

The GeForce 7950 GTX is being targeted as a solution for Extreme High Definition (XHD) gaming, which includes playing at widescreen resolutions up to 2560x1600. At 2560x1600, Dell's new 30-inch LCD provides a whopping 78% increase in the number of pixels over the default 1920x1200 resolution of a recently acquired Dell 24-inch LCD.

Based on pricing at launch, the GeForce 7950 GX2 looks to be positioned between the GeForce 7900 GTX in a single and SLI configuration.

Specifications Comparison

The GeForce 7950 GX2 features an NVIDIA custom-developed PCI Express switch that directs the PCI Express connection from the system to both GPUs.
